Piezoelectric materials can be broadly categorized as ceramic, polymer, or single crystal kinds.
The most prevalent phases in PVDF-based materials are α nonpolar phase and β polar phases.

However, the rain flow counting, which simultaneously calculates the load amplitude and mean load, has several advantages as follows: ① it is easily to be accepted that there is a link between statistical analysis on load and fatigue properties of materials; ② the two- parameter counting method not only acquires the trend statistics but also avoids loss of small alternating signals; ③ each part of load time spectrum is calculated once;④ it is convenient to accomplish computer processing and automation of data handling.
